They doesn't work right, because xml attributes where
stripped down, and leading zeros are removed.
E.g. instead of
<carrier_config mcc="262" mnc="06">
the values are modified and get
<carrier_config mcc="262" mnc="6">
This prevents matching of defined carrier definitions.

Google's prebuilt cgroups.json and task_profiles.json for products
launched with previous API levels only covers
ro.product.first_api_level >= 28. [1]
These devices were launched with M (API level 23), so schedtune
and task groups are completely broken. Since the system also checks
/vendor/etc for vendor profiles, make a copy of cgroups_28.json
and task_profiles_28.json and ship them to /vendor/etc. Profiles
for previous API levels are all the same anyway.
Test: boot and check /dev/stune/

Runtime Resource Overlays (RROs) can no longer change the value of
resources in manifest when read during PackagerParser.
This change uses component-override to enable the service by default.
Remove usages of profile_supported_* from overlays as they no
longer configure the enable state of Bluetooth components.
